Transaction 93e7a27d210200c7d8de4cb0bd2b00a7e2e758831252599fffc46691be1c5ca8

1 Input
2 Outputs
  • 93e7a27d210200c7d8de4cb0bd2b00a7e2e758831252599fffc46691be1c5ca8:0
  • value  25582392
    address  34zwe5zVfBMxuk4WgzKo9txAbBRACZ2J8h
  • 93e7a27d210200c7d8de4cb0bd2b00a7e2e758831252599fffc46691be1c5ca8:1
  • value  5100
    address  3MjL3Ks2MeMrX4nwVz9eKPBBiHMPzRpmci